i am in limbo. you know, that hellhole between the microsecond you graduate from high school and the first step you take onto your college campus in the fall. limbo. a time where everything seems strangely out of place, especially yourself, your body, your mind. you're definately out of high school and eager to disassociate yourself from all things of the past, but you're not immersed in college yet, not quite ready (though you proclaim yourself to be) to tackle the problems living by oneself can bring. yeah. that's where i am. ready to make new friends but hesitant to discard my old ones (make new friends, but keep the old...one is silver and the other's gold). ready to start a new life but desperate to keep parts of my old life like i'm desperate to keep this ratty teddy bear called teddy (how original) that my great-aunt ruthie gave to me when i was three days old. i don't remember my great-aunt ruthie other than her annoyingly sweet baby powder smell but i want to keep this bear. i don't even remember all the good times with my friends but i want them all anyway to store in the photo album/abyss of my mind until the pages yellow and fade and the pictures corrode and lose their color, their irridescent shine.
